Abstract
PURPOSE The aim of this study was to identify risk factors for the loss of corrected distance visual acuity (CDVA) after uncomplicated hyperopic laser-assisted in situ keratomileusis (LASIK). METHODS A retrospective study including hyperopic patients who underwent microkeratome-assisted LASIK between January 2000 and December 2019 at Care-Vision Laser Centers, Tel-Aviv, Israel. Loss of CDVA was defined as ≥ 2 lines (0.20 logarithm of the minimum angle of resolution [logMAR] increase). Excluded were patients who had loss of CDVA because of intraoperative or postoperative complications or developed cataract at their final visit. RESULTS Overall, 1998 eyes of 1998 patients were included in the study, of which 35 eyes (1.75%) had CDVA loss at final follow-up (mean 387 days). The vision-loss group had a significantly greater spherical treatment (3.4 vs. 2.8 D, P = 0.02), ablation depth (69.4 vs. 53.8 μm, P = 0.01), a higher proportion of treatments with a smaller optic zone (6.0 mm) (31.4% vs. 13.4%, P = 0.002), treatment with the EX200 (Alcon) excimer rather than the EX500 (Alcon) (74.3% vs. 39.0%, P < 0.001), and treatment with the Moria M2-90 microkeratome rather than the Moria Sub-Bowman's keratomileusis (SBK) microkeratome (65.7% vs. 29.6%, P < 0.001). In multivariate binary logistic regression, factors that remained significant predictors of CDVA loss were a greater spherical treatment (per 1 D treatment, odds ratio = 1.42, 95% CI, 1.11-1.81, P = 0.004) and the use of the Moria M2-90 microkeratome (odds ratio = 4.66, 95% CI, 2.30-9.45, P < 0.001). CONCLUSIONS In patients undergoing uncomplicated hyperopic LASIK, a greater spherical hyperopic treatment is associated with a higher risk for vision loss. Transition to a newer microkeratome model significantly reduced vision loss rate.

Abstract
PURPOSE To report modern outcomes of femtosecond laser-assisted cataract surgery (FS-LASIK) for the correction of moderate-to-high hyperopia (≥3.50 diopters [D] and ≤6.50 D), excluding low or very high hyperopia. SETTING Vissum, Alicante, Spain. DESIGN Monocentric retrospective case series study. METHODS Visumax-500 kHz femtosecond laser and Amaris-750 excimer-laser were used. Eyes with at least 6 months of follow-up were included. 36-month data was collected when available. Primary outcome measure was short term efficacy and safety. Secondary outcome measure was long term stability. RESULTS 6-month data of 92 eyes was collected (68 eyes at 36 months). Mean age was 34.6 ± 10.4 years. Mean treated sphere was 4.69 ± 0.87. Efficacy index was 0.91 and 0.90 at 6 months and 36 months respectively. Safety index was 1.00. Uncorrected distance visual acuity was 20/20 or better in 72%, postoperative spherical equivalent within 0.5 D in 80% (93% within 1 D), and loss of 1 line of corrected distance visual acuity (CDVA) occurred in 13% (2 or more lines in 0%). Gain of 1 or more CDVA lines occurred in 17%. A slight but significant regression was observed at 36 months. Postoperatively, 21.73% required flap lift for laser enhancement, and 11.95% an orthoptic visual rehabilitation due to accommodative disorders. CONCLUSIONS Modern LASIK provides good efficacy and safety levels for the management of moderate to high hyperopia (up to +6.5 D), with levels close to those previously reported with refractive lens exchange for young hyperopia patients without presbyopia, where we defend the maintenance of LASIK as first line therapy. Risk of requiring a refractive enhancement or an orthoptic visual rehabilitation remains relevant and needs to be discussed with patients preoperatively.

Abstract
PURPOSE To investigate the safety and effectiveness of small incision lenticule extraction (SMILE) in patients who have hyperopia with or without astigmatism. METHODS This was a prospective multicenter trial including 374 eyes of 199 patients treated by SMILE for hyperopia using the VisuMax femtosecond laser (Carl Zeiss Meditec AG). Inclusion criteria were sphere up to +6.00 diopters (D), cylinder up to 5.00 D, and maximum hyperopic meridian up to +7.00 D, with preoperative corrected distance visual acuity (CDVA) of 20/25 or better. The optical zone was 6.3 mm with a transition zone of 2 mm. The minimum lenticule thickness was set at 25 µm in the center and at 10 µm at the edge. Patients were examined at 1 day, 1 week, and 1, 3, 6, 9, and 12 months after surgery. Standard refractive surgery outcomes analysis was performed. RESULTS The preoperative spherical equivalent was +3.20 ± 1.48 D (range: +0.25 to +6.50 D). At the 12-month follow-up visit, 81% of eyes treated were within ±0.50 D and 93% of eyes were within ±1.00 D of intended correction. A total of 1.2% of eyes lost two or more lines of CDVA at the 12-month follow-up visit, and 83% were at least 20/20, corresponding to a safety index of 1.005 at 12 months. Of the 219 eyes with plano target, 68.8% had an uncorrected distance visual acuity of 20/20 or better and 88% were at least 20/25 uncorrected at 12 months. There were no statistically significant changes in contrast sensitivity. CONCLUSIONS SMILE was found to be an effective treatment method for the correction of compound hyperopic astigmatism, demonstrating a high level of efficacy, predictability, safety, and stability. Abstract
Purpose To compare clinical outcomes following LASIK for myopia performed with MEL 90 vs. Schwind Amaris 750S excimer laser. Methods Data were collected retrospectively for patients who underwent Femto-LASIK, using the MEL 90 and Schwind Amaris 750S excimer laser for correction of myopia and myopic astigmatism within the range of -1.00 to -10.00 D SE from January 2013 till June 2018. Outcomes were analysed at 12 months for safety, efficacy, enhancement rate, and long-term complications. Results A total of 328 eyes of 328 patients were analysed. One hundred and sixty-three eyes were treated with Schwind Amaris and the remaining 165 eyes with the MEL 90 laser. Twelve months postoperatively, the mean UDVA, CDVA, residual SE, and cylinder in the Amaris group were -0.10 ± 0.09 logMAR, -0.14 ± 0.06 logMAR, -0.21 ± 0.22 D, -0.13 ± 0.18 D versus -0.05 ± 0.07 logMAR, -0.09 ± 0.08 logMAR, -0.23 ± 0.23 D, and -0.14 ± 0.21 D for the MEL 90 group (p values >0.05). For the Amaris group, safety and efficacy indices were 1.12 and 1.02, whereas for the MEL 90 group, these indices were 1.08 and 1.00, respectively. No eye in either group had any postop flap-related complications, infectious keratitis, diffuse lamellar keratitis, or keratectasia. Two eyes in the Amaris and 4 eyes in MEL 90 group required enhancement for the progression of myopia. Conclusion At 12 months, both Schwind Amaris 750S and MEL 90 lasers demonstrated comparable clinical outcomes for myopic LASIK in a single surgeon setting.

Abstract
Introduction Laser-assisted in-situ keratomileusis (LASIK) for the correction of hyperopia and hyperopic astigmatism is challenging and has been less studied than for the correction of myopia and myopic astigmatism. The aim of this study was to analyze the refractive outcomes of LASIK in hyperopia and hyperopic astigmatic eyes using a wave-front optimized laser platform (the Allegretto EX500 laser) and perform a historical comparison with other excimer lasers within the past two decades. Methods A one-center (Tertiary Refractive Center, Draper, Utah), retrospective, non-comparative study was conducted on 379 eyes treated with LASIK for hyperopia and hyperopic astigmatism. The data retrieved on these eyes were analyzed using uncorrected distance visual acuity (UDVA), corrected distance visual acuity (CDVA), and spherical equivalents. A literature search of excimer platforms in use in the past 20 years and a comparison of US Federal Drug Administration-approved platforms for hyperopia were performed. Results At 3 and 12 months postoperatively, 142 (66%) and 81 (69%) eyes had a UDVA of 20/20 or better and 207 (96%) and 114 (97%) eyes had a UDVA of 20/40 or better, respectively. The mean refractive spherical equivalent was − 0.52 ± 0.78 D at 3 months and − 0.46 ± 0.79 D at 12 months. At 12 months, 181 (96%) eyes achieved a spherical equivalent within ± 1.00 D of the intended target. Studies published before 2005 reported lower rates of UDVA 20/20 or better (32%) compared to those published after (68%); however, this discrepancy was less evident for UDVA 20/40 or better. A similar trend towards improved accuracy was noted in the literature with postoperative manifest refractive spherical equivalent within ± 0.50 D before and after 2005. Conclusion There has been significant improvement in safety, efficacy, stability, and accuracy of LASIK treatment for hyperopia and hyperopic astigmatism within the past two decades. Newer excimer lasers meet industry standards and in particular, the Allegretto EX500 used in this study exceeded industry standards.

Abstract
Introduction The WaveLight Allegretto Eye-Q is a flying-spot excimer laser, with a pulse repetition rate of 400Hz, with two galvanometric scanners for positioning laser pulses. The system has an infrared high speed camera operating at 400Hz to track the patient's eye movements that either compensates for changes in eye position or interrupts the treatment if the eye moves outside a preset predetermined range. Aim The purpose of this study was to investigate WaveLight Allegretto Eye-Q 400Hz laser delivery platform aimed to correct astigmatism by subjecting the pre and postoperative astigmatic values to vector analysis. Methods Patients were divided into two groups, depending on the type of astigmatism. Astigmatism was between 2 and 7 diopters (D). A total of 188 eyes (110 patients), 127 eyes (71 patients) with myopic astigmatism and 61 eyes (39 patients) with mixed astigmatism underwent unremarkable LASIK correction on WaveLight Allegretto Eye-Q 400Hz. The preoperative and postoperative sphere, negative cylinder [C] and axis (ø) of manifest refractions were subjected to vector analysis by calculations of the standard J0 (cos [4π(ø-90)/360]xC/2) and J45 (sin[4π(ø-90)/ 360]xC/2). Results Reporting the key results, we found that J0 significantly reduced after LASIK (p<0.001) but not J45. There was no significant association between individual pairs of pre and postoperative J0 &J45 values. Conclusion WaveLight Allegretto 400Hz showed excellent results for treating patients with high astigmatism, regardless whether it is mixed or myopic astigmatism. The J45 did not reduce significantly possibly because of the low number of eyes with oblique astigmatism. There was no genuine difference postoperatively between groups treated on WaveLight Allegretto platform according to the vector analyses.
